I'm a mommy with a boy of almost 8months. I faced the exact same situation faced by your friend. I directly BF baby for 2 months and I had to return to work afterwards. So I pumped milk and gave my babysitter EBM everyday but my baby just wouldn't drink. I tried so many nipples also lah! Avent, NUK, Pureen Wide Neck, MAM etc etc. Never worked, cos mistake I did was never introduced bottle to my baby during the initial 2 months!
Then after I changed my babysitter, she tried feeding baby with EBM from a small spoon, then bit by bit baby got used to EBM. Then I bought Pigeon yellow color nipple which is quite soft and my baby liked it. After that I had no problem giving him EBM from bottle. So he still drinks...
